How To Fix FKK_ID_JP008 - Field &1 is defined multiple times


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: FKK_ID_JP - FICA Japan

  • Message number: 008

  • Message text: Field &1 is defined multiple times

    The SAP error message FKK_ID_JP008, which states "Field &1 is defined multiple times," typically occurs in the context of the SAP Convergent Charging (SAP CC) or SAP Contract Accounts Receivable and Payable (SAP FI-CA) modules. This error indicates that a specific field (denoted by &1) has been defined more than once in a particular context, leading to ambiguity in processing.

    Cause:

    1. Duplicate Field Definitions: The most common cause of this error is that the same field has been defined multiple times in a configuration or data structure, such as in a data model, a table, or a report.
    2. Incorrect Customization: If there have been recent changes or customizations made to the system, it is possible that these changes inadvertently introduced duplicate field definitions.
    3. Data Migration Issues: If data has been migrated from another system or from legacy data, it may have resulted in duplicate entries for certain fields.

    Solution:

    1. Identify the Field: Check the error message for the specific field name indicated by &1. This will help you pinpoint where the duplication is occurring.
    2. Review Configuration: Go through the relevant configuration settings in SAP to identify where the field is defined. This could involve looking at data models, structures, or any custom developments.
    3. Remove Duplicates: Once you identify the duplicate definitions, remove or consolidate them to ensure that each field is defined only once.
    4. Check Custom Code: If there is custom code involved, review it to ensure that it does not create duplicate field definitions.
    5. Test Changes: After making the necessary adjustments, test the changes in a development or quality assurance environment before moving them to production.
